dc.description.abstract As space missions grow longer and more complex, reliable power is crucial. WPT enables remote energy transmission via microwaves or lasers, reducing spacecraft mass and fuel needs while providing power in shadowed or deep-space areas. It can support satellites without solar arrays, deep-space probes, and electric propulsion. Advances in rectennas, beamforming, metamaterials, and receivers improve efficiency, range, and safety. Though experimental, WPT offers scalable solutions for lunar bases, Martian habitats, and satellite constellations, with potential to become central to future space infrastructure. en_US
